Norm Noble Gary Whiting is a long-time member of the Sun Lakes Rotary Club, serving as its President in Rotary year 2000-2001 and then serving as Arizona Rotary District 5510 Centennial Governor in Rotary year 2004-2005. This year, he chaired the club’s Website Committee which undertook much-needed overhauling with a new platform and new ideas…

Essential Oil workshop
Connie Koehler Join us for an essential oil workshop on Wednesday, July 12, from 1:00-2:00 p.m., at the SunBird Golf Resort Clubhouse, Navajo Room (3rd floor), 6250 SunBird Blvd. The topic will be Oil Blends that Rid Our Bodies of Cellulite. Shelley Zavarella and Paullene Caraher will host a workshop to make an oil blend…
